Last December 5, Johannes Heesters was… 107 years!
This Dutch actor and entertainer still continues to amaze those who interview him for the accuracy in the dates and names when he remembers his career.
From last 19th of November till the 19th of February 2011, The Queen Sofia Spanish Institute in New York is showing the first exhibition to consider the impact of Spain’s culture, history and art on one of its greatests twentieth-century sons, the legendary designer Cristobal Balenciaga (1895-1972). Hailed as “Fashion’s Picasso” by Cecil Beaton, Balenciaga’s innovations transformed the way women dressed, from the opening of his Paris fashion house in 1937 until his retirement in 1968. His visionary designs and impeccable standards seduced generations of the best-dressed women in the world.

“Many passengers are taking a ride through history aboard vintage subway cars.
For the next few weekends, the Metropolitan Transportation Authority will be rolling out the old subway cars every Sunday.
The cars first made their debut back in 1932 and ran throughout the city until the 1970s.
Many riders and transit enthusiasts say it's a rare opportunity to get an up-close look at an integral part of the city's history.
